### Configuration
Once deployed, the mapper must be enabled for the realm in the specific Identity Provider Mappers.
Specific settings are present:
- **`Use Libravatar service`**: Enable or not the avatar discovery on the libravatar (gravatar) service
- **`Import avatar in a separate thread`**: the import of the avatar will be performed asynch in a separate thread to improve speed during a new identity import

# Avatar Realm Resource
**Avatar Realm Resource** defines the new avatar resource inside Keycloak and exposes it on REST, implements the SPI defined in the `avatar-storage` module to store avatars on file system or in an user's property; the last option is discouraged since the DB's property mapping could be limited by the JDBC driver/JPA settings/DB defaults.
**Avatar Realm Resource** defines the new avatar resource inside Keycloak and exposes it on REST, implements the SPI defined in the `avatar-storage` module to store avatars on a S3 persistence, on file system or in an user's property; the use of the last option is discouraged since the DB's property mapping could be limited by the JDBC driver/JPA settings/DB defaults.

### Installation and configuration
#### Qurkus based Keycloak
The type of the storage to be used is configured in the `org.gcube.keycloak.avatar.storage.AvatarStorageProviderFactory` file under the `META-INF/services/` folder of the module source/JAR.
To use the S3 persistence, the content of the file should be: `org.gcube.keycloak.avatar.storage.s3.MinioAvatarStorageProviderFactory`
#### Quarkus based Keycloak
In order to deploy the module it is sufficient to copy into the `[keycloak-home]/providers` folder.
#####
If you need to customize the folder where avatars images are saved (defaulting `[user-home]/avatar`) you can add the following line to the `[keycloak-home]/conf/keycloak.conf` file:
spi-avatar-storage-avatar-storage-file-avatar-folder=[full-path-to-the-avatar-folder]
